The Eaton advanced mounting rail is engineered for seamless integration within The Eaton xEnergy Safety Ci LV systems, delivering a robust solution to LV switchgear applications. Designed with precision, it boasts exceptional durability thanks to its galvanized steel construction, ensuring long-lasting performance in demanding environments. The product's dimensions are meticulously crafted to optimise installation efficiency while accommodating standard enclosures. With a focus on safety and reliability, this mounting rail is an ideal choice for professionals seeking quality solutions in electrical distribution systems. The combination of functionality and aesthetic appeal ensures that it not only meets but exceeds modern industry standards.

Constructed from high-quality galvanized steel for enhanced longevity
Engineered to support a variety of LV switchgear applications
Designed to facilitate easy and efficient installation
Includes captive fixing screws for secure mounting
Complements the aesthetic of modern electrical systems
Optimised dimensions for compatibility with standard enclosures
Provides a reliable solution for safe power distribution
Offers versatility across multiple installation environments
